Narrowband IoT, also known as NB-IoT, is a low-power, wide-area network technology that is specifically designed for connecting small, low-power devices over long distances Unlike traditional IoT technologies that rely on high-bandwidth, Narrowband IoT operates on a narrowband frequency, allowing it to provide efficient and cost-effective connectivity for a wide range of IoT applications This makes it an ideal solution for connecting devices that need to transmit small amounts of data over long periods of time, such as smart meters, environmental sensors, and asset trackers.

One of the key features of Narrowband IoT is its ability to operate in remote and challenging environments By utilizing a narrowband frequency, this technology is able to penetrate deep into buildings, underground structures, and other hard-to-reach areas where traditional cellular networks may struggle to provide coverage This makes Narrowband IoT an ideal solution for applications such as smart city infrastructure, agriculture monitoring, and industrial automation, where reliable connectivity is essential.

Another important feature of Narrowband IoT is its low power consumption By using optimized communication protocols and power-saving mechanisms, NB-IoT devices can operate on a single battery for years at a time, making them ideal for applications that require long-term monitoring and maintenance-free operation This low power consumption also makes Narrowband IoT a cost-effective solution, as it reduces the need for frequent battery replacements and maintenance, thus lowering the total cost of ownership for IoT deployments.
